Abstract

An experimental investigation of the hydraulic cuttability of coal from the Theiss Dampier Mitsui mine near Moura, Central Queen land illustrated the ability of established cutting equations to describe the behaviour of the coal during cutting. The experimental equipment developed for the work proved reliable. The results of the experimental programme are consistent with accumulated experience from overseas.
